Biography
Wallace Howe (March 4, 1878, in Fitchburg, Massachusetts – November 23, 1957, in Los Angeles, California), born Orlando Wallace Howe, was an American film actor. He appeared in 104 films between 1918 and 1936, including many films with Harold Lloyd and Stan Laurel, and in short films with the original Our Gang.
